Headline: Deep dive into the top Cyber Stories making headlines in the first quarter of 2024
Topic 1: Emerging Threats and Trends
Let’s explore the latest cyber threats and trends, including ransomware attacks, supply chain vulnerabilities, and emerging technologies such as AI. We will consider South African stories making cybersecurity headlines – is there a trend/pattern?
Topic 2: Incident Response and Cyber Resilience
Let’s delve into strategies for effective incident response, crisis management, and building cyber-resilient organizations capable of withstanding and recovering from cyber-attacks. What is best practice?
